So I changed Ticks formula from that awful petlac to the Esbilac powder kind this morning. After a couple of feeding he did great so I went ahead and did a full strength feeding. No diarrhea so I'm guessing it was Ok. The problem is.. When I changed it a few hours later I noticed a change in his urinating habit. He usually soaks a qtip and I have to dab him up with a tissue. Now I can't get anything out of him and I'm terrified he's gonna get sick or die.. Is this normal or could this be another problem? I did substitute a feeding for 1cc of just plain water about 45min to an hr ago.. Still not even a drip :(

Make sure that he isn't "self sucking" so that there's a scab forming on his penis.
I would think you would easily see that though.
Could he be urinating on his own in his bedding? Feel around for any wet spots.
Make sure that you are making the formula with 1 part powdered formula to 2 parts
HOT water. Make this ahead of time, and let it sit in the refrig for about 6-8 hours.
Always stir or shake well before using.
Some people will make formula ahead and put it in ice cube trays and freeze after
it's sat in the refrig. Then the night before, defrost one or two cubes, for the following day.
You can do water hydration in between feedings as well.
We don't substitute formula feedings, we do hydration feedings in between formula feedings.
Keep him on the same formula feeding schedule, just add the hydration feeding in between.
How much is your little one taking, and what is his weight?

It is possible that he's urninating on his own, but we don't want to "count" on that.
Do a couple of hydration feedings in between formula feedings.
There are some that don't let it sit, they make it up and feed.
I think it dissolves better if it sits longer.
I always make large batches and freeze them, it works out great.
When I'm on my last batch, I make more, let it sit in the refrig and
then freeze.
SO you can feed him with what you have now,
and in the future, let it sit in the refrig.
Clear pee is good, as yellow or darker could be a sign of dehydration.
